Output 3cfa4a5da3fb1037b21d0e3d2ea668107e36aa3b5cfdc2dd2c0ded26ffcb4bf0: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1503bb71d7142848e01239e38a21bc279214df OP_EQUAL
address
3HZUg3KTxwffAkzX8F5UdimX42QArgWMTy
transaction
3cfa4a5da3fb1037b21d0e3d2ea668107e36aa3b5cfdc2dd2c0ded26ffcb4bf0
confirmations
59458
spent
true